Hedge cutting is essential for keeping the health, shape, and look of hedges and shrubs. Routine pruning removes dead or infected branches, motivates dense development, and makes sure uniformity fit and height. Correct trimming techniques differ depending on the types, growth routine, and preferred visual. Tools such as hand shears, electrical trimmers, or hedge cutters permit accuracy and performance, while security factors to consider prevent accidental injury or plant damage. Timing is vital, with seasonal cutting schedules often aligned with blooming cycles or development durations. Well-maintained hedges provide practical benefits such as privacy, wind defense, and property delineation, while enhancing the general landscape style. Constant hedge care contributes to long-lasting plant health and continual visual appeal
